In today's digital age, cybersecurity has become a critical aspect of small businesses. With the increasing demand for professionals who can ensure the safety of sensitive data, non-technical individuals can benefit from a certificate programme in Small Business Cybersecurity. This programme focuses on equipping learners with the essential skills to protect businesses from cyber threats, making them attractive candidates for various roles in the industry. 1. **Cybersecurity Analyst**: Professionals in this role monitor networks for security breaches and analyze potential vulnerabilities. They often recommend and implement security measures to prevent cyber attacks. 2. **Security Consultant**: Security consultants evaluate an organization's IT infrastructure to identify potential threats and vulnerabilities. They design and implement security solutions tailored to their client's needs. 3. **IT Manager**: IT managers oversee the organization's technology systems, ensuring their smooth operation and security. They coordinate, plan, and lead IT projects, such as network upgrades and cybersecurity implementation. 4. **Compliance Officer**: Compliance officers ensure organizations follow laws, regulations, and standards related to data protection and privacy. They develop and implement policies and procedures to help their organization maintain compliance. 5. **Security Awareness Training Specialist**: These professionals create and deliver training programs to educate employees on cybersecurity best practices. Their goal is to minimize human error, a common cause of security breaches.
